
Pakistani supermodel and actress Saheefa Jabbar Khattak is once again making headlines—this time for her bold and controversial remarks about overseas Pakistanis. Known for her unfiltered opinions and outspoken personality, Saheefa has reignited public debate with her latest statements about life abroad and national mindset.
Saheefa’s Comeback & Current Focus

After a brief break from mainstream television, Saheefa Jabbar Khattak has shifted her attention toward digital platforms and social media. While she is not actively signing new drama projects, she continues to stay relevant through candid conversations, lifestyle content, and thought-provoking opinions.
Her personal journey, including struggles with mental health and depression, has also kept her in the public eye. Recently, she returned to Pakistan after spending time abroad, bringing fresh perspectives that are now sparking heated discussions online.
Viral Interview on GupShab
During a recent appearance on a talk show, Saheefa opened up about her experience of moving to Canada with her husband. When asked about the emotional challenges many Pakistanis face after relocating overseas, her response stood out.
Unlike other celebrities such as Sanam Jung, who have openly discussed homesickness and cultural adjustment struggles, Saheefa offered a completely different perspective.
“Stop the Hypocrisy” – Saheefa Speaks Out
Saheefa Jabbar Khattak did not hold back as she labeled overseas Pakistanis “hypocrites” for complaining about life abroad. According to her, people who choose to move to countries like Canada should fully embrace the lifestyle, laws, and systems there.
She emphasized that life abroad offers structure, opportunity, and comfort—yet many Pakistanis still complain and romanticize their life back home. Saheefa pointed out that missing household help, old routines, and familiar environments should not be used as excuses for dissatisfaction.
A Different Take on Overseas Life
Her comments challenge a common narrative among the Pakistani diaspora. Many overseas Pakistanis often share emotional stories about missing their homeland, family traditions, and cultural identity.
However, Saheefa believes that such sentiments sometimes reflect unrealistic expectations. She suggests that people should mentally prepare for a completely different lifestyle before moving abroad, rather than comparing it constantly with life in Pakistan.
Public Reaction & Social Media Buzz
As expected, Saheefa’s remarks have gone viral across social media platforms in Pakistan. While some users agree with her stance on adapting to new environments, others have criticized her for generalizing the experiences of overseas Pakistanis.
